ObjectiveC-NSMutable array specific indexes stored in another array

Is there anyway I can add specific objects in NSMutableArray to another array in objective c? I can accomplish that in Java but cannot figure it our for objective c
For example I have an array of 7 strings and I only want indexes 1, 3 ,7 stored in another array.
Here is one way of creating the array from the string values at particular indexes:
NSMutableArray *array = ...; // Array with strings
NSArray *someOtherArray = #[ array[1], array[3], array[7] ];
So both array[1] and someOtherArray[0] point to the same (NSString) instance, etc.
This is what NSIndexSet (and NSMutableIndexSet) is for.
You can build it manually or use helper methods on NSArray like:
indexesOfObjectsPassingTest:
to build an index set from a block. You can then enumerate over the NSIndexSet using a for loop - using the index to call into the original array.

NSMutableArray cast to swift Array of custom type

I'd like to figure out how to specify or cast an NSMutableArray to a swift Array of a custom type. I currently have 2 files:
First file requires an NSMutableArray for its functionality (passed by reference, ability to remove particular objects with indices I don't know)
Second file uses a Swift array (better memory / throwaway array), with a custom type, which I declare using
let newArray: [CustomType]!
I need to pass the NSMutableArray in as a parameter to a function in the second file, which requires a [CustomType]. When simply calling it:
let newVC = UIViewController(array: mutableArray)
it keeps telling me 'CustomType' is not identical to 'AnyObject'. I've tried calling the function using mutableArray as [CustomType], which does not work either. How can I make the swift Array function accept my NSMutableArray?
This works for me:
var swiftArray = NSArray(array:mutableArray) as Array<CustomType>
swiftArray is then a Swift array of objects of CustomType. You can pass the array and iterate over it as you would expect.

Objective C : Array

I am new to objective C and trying to learn it. I am trying to write calculator program which performs simple mathematical calculation(addition, subtraction and so forth).
I want to create an array which stores for numbers(double value) and operands. Now, my pushOperand method takes ID as below:
-(void) pushOperand:(id)operand
{
[self.inputStack addObject:operand];
}
when I try to push double value as below:
- (IBAction)enterPressed:(UIButton *)sender
{
[self.brain pushOperand:[self.displayResult.text doubleValue]];
}
It gives my following error: "Sending 'double' to parameter of incompatible type 'id'"
I would appreciate if you guys can answer my following questions:
'id' is a generic type so I would assume it will work with any type without giving error above. Can you please help me understand the real reason behind the error?
How can I resolve this error?
id is a pointer to any class. Hence, it does not work with primitive types such as double or int which are neither pointers, nor objects. To store a primitive type in an NSArray, one must first wrap the primitive in an NSNumber object. This can be done in using alloc/init or with the new style object creation, as shown in the two snippets below.
old style
NSNumber *number = [[NSNumber alloc] initWithDouble:[self.displayResult.text doubleValue]];
[self.brain pushOperand:number];
new style
NSNumber *number = #( [self.displayResult.text doubleValue] );
[self.brain pushOperand:number];

ios NSUinteger to type 'id'

My brain is failing me today. I know this has got to be a simple one, but I just don't see it.
CGFloat *minutes = [self.displayData objectForKey:index];
Incompatible integer to pointer conversion sending 'NSUInteger' (aka 'unsigned int') to parameter of type 'id'
index is a NSUInteger in a loop, (0 1 2 3 etc)
How do I get past this one? Thanks.
The dictionary waits for an object as the key (id) rather than a plain integer (NSUInteger).
Try wrapping the integer in a NSNumber object.
CGFloat *minutes = [self.displayData objectForKey:[NSNumber numberWithUnsignedInteger:index]];
The -objectForKey: method returns a value of type id, but you're trying to assign that to a CGFloat*, which isn't compatible with id because CGFloat isn't a class. If you know that the object you're retrieving from the dictionary is a certain type, say an NSNumber, you can take steps to convert it to a CGFloat when you get it.
Also, you're trying to use an int as a key into a dictionary, but dictionaries require their keys to be objects too. If you want to access your objects by index, store them in an array instead of a dictionary.
Putting it all together, you'd have something like this:
// after changing the displayData to an array
NSNumber *number = [self.displayData objectAtIndex:index];
CGFloat minutes = [number floatValue];
